When Moving to Another State, how to Load for College

Loading your things and transferring to college is hard enough, include in a cross country move, and things get a little more complicated. If you're moving to another state, across the country or to another country, then these ideas on how to load and move are simply for you.
Sort Your Stuff and Only Take What You Truly Need

If you're moving far away and won't be back house for a while, it's a great idea to sort through your closet and drawers, dividing your things into three piles: 1) keep, 2) giveaway and, 3) get rid of. If you're having a difficult time choosing what's a "keeper" and what's not, ask yourself when the last time you used it or utilized it.

When you have your keep pile, set it aside and tackle the giveaway and toss piles. If you understand of a good friend, brother or sister, cousin or another deserving person, who might want the things you're giving away, ask if they can use it.

The things you can't distribute, donate to charity. There are great deals of charities around that will take gently-used products. Simply ensure that your things aren't ripped or broken or chipped. Stuff that remains in bad condition ought to be added to your "toss" pile.

And remember to not be too hasty in tossing things away. Youth items you may want to reserve, simply in case.
Strategy for 3 to 6 Months

Because you're moving far and may not be back for a while, try to believe about what you'll require for the next three to six months. Believe seasons. What are the vital clothes pieces you'll require in the fall and what can bring you through to the winter season if you prepare on staying away from home longer? And consider packaging just important pieces, like a coat, boots, a couple of pairs of shoes, etc. Don't take every jacket or coat you own, rather set down as much as possible.

And don't take it if you aren't sure you'll wear it that much. Once again, believe fundamentals, not "maybes.".
Intend On Buying Things There.

Don't equip up on school products at house only to have to move them with you. Plan to buy some of your essentials at your new area, specifically products that are easy to find. In addition to school products, reassess whether you desire to pack all your toiletries (shampoo, soap, and so on).

Books must also be purchased at website your brand-new school. Attempt not to take books with you. You'll have access to libraries, book shops, and textbook shops where you're going.
Reserve Things to Ship.

The things that you aren't packing for immediate usage set it aside to be delivered later. If you have time, you can even prepare it for shipping. Box it up and leave instructions for your parents or good friends to send more info at a later date. You can likewise choose how finest to deliver your things to your brand-new home, get more info so you're not leaving this decision to the last minute.
